What does the following quotation help you to understand about Amelia?

"If I marry, my groom will likely be an actual groom!"

A) She is miserable
B) She does not like grooms
C) She can be funny and has a sense of humor
D) She is wise and experienced

Answer:

The quotation helps us understand the following about Amelia:

C) She can be funny and has a sense of humor.

Step-by-step explanation:

She starts off by saying "if I marry", which can sound miserable, but it is actually funny if we read the rest of the sentence:

"If I marry, my groom will likely be an actual groom!"

Amelia uses absurdity as a form of humor. By saying "my groom will likely be an actual groom", she makes a funny remark, especially by using the words "likely" and "actual", which make it for the whole absurd and funny aspect of it. Amelia makes fun of herself, and that is a trait of people who can be funny and have a sense of humor.
